生源半径等于1.5 圆柱高h=3 求圆周长 圆面积 圆球表面积 圆球体积 原著企及是看输入数据 输入计算结果 输入时要有文字说明 取小数点后两位数字 请编程序
时间: 2024-10-14 12:13:36 浏览: 18
您好,您提到的问题似乎涉及到了数学和编程方面的求解。首先,我们需要明确的是,给出的信息“生源半径”在这个上下文中并不明显,可能是有误,我假设您是指圆柱的底面半径为1.5米,高度为3米。
下面是基于这个假设,编写一个简化的Python程序来计算:
```python
import math
# 定义变量
radius = 1.5
height = 3
# 圆周长 (C)
circumference = 2 * math.pi * radius
print(f"圆周长:{format(circumference, '.2f')} 米")
# 圆面积 (A)
area = math.pi * radius ** 2
print(f"圆面积:{format(area, '.2f')} 平方米")
# 如果这是一个圆柱体,它的侧面积会是一个长方形,不是圆,我们只算底面圆的面积
# 因此只计算圆形底面积
# 圆球相关的计算需要知道球的直径,因为题目里没有提供,我们就先假设它是圆柱底面直径,即3米
diameter = 2 * radius
sphere_radius = diameter / 2
# 圆球表面积 (SA)
ball_surface_area = 4 * math.pi * sphere_radius ** 2
print(f"圆球表面积(假设球基于圆柱底面直径):{format(ball_surface_area, '.2f')} 平方米")
# 圆球体积 (V)
ball_volume = (4/3) * math.pi * sphere_radius ** 3
print(f"圆球体积(同样基于圆柱底面直径):{format(ball_volume, '.2f')} 立方米")
```
如果您提供的“生源半径”实际上是另一个参数,请提供正确的值,以便进行精确的计算。同时,如果需要根据不同的数据输入动态计算,还需要增加用户输入部分。
阅读全文